Lorraine Rose is a clinical psychologist, psychoanalytic psychotherapist and organizational consultant who has worked in private practice for over 40 years. She has lectured at a number of universities and taught in teaching programs for trainees in psychoanalytic psychotherapy and established Infant Observation for the Institute of Psychiatry Infant Mental Health Course, NSW. Her private practice work has included work with children, adolescents, adults and families. A particular focus has been adults who have never bonded as babies, needing longer-term intensive treatment. Lorraine studied group phenomena at the post graduate level and was a member/board member of the Australian Institute of Socio-Analysis (AISA) now known as Group Relations Australia (GRA). Her previous book, Learning to Love: The developing relationships between mother, father and baby during the first year, was published by ACER Press, 2000
